Description

A stylish first-floor apartment in the highly sought-after Deganwy area, perfect for professionals, couples or downsizers seeking a coastal lifestyle. Offering two generous bedrooms, contemporary open-plan living and breathtaking sea views, this home combines modern comfort with scenic surroundings, all within easy reach of local amenities, transport links and the marina.

The Tour

Situated within a well-maintained and secure development, this first-floor apartment is accessed via a communal entrance with intercom system and lift to all floors, setting the tone for the quality throughout.

Stepping into the apartment, you are welcomed by a central hallway from which all rooms flow, creating a practical and well-balanced layout.

To the rear of the property lies the true showpiece, an impressive open plan kitchen, living and dining space. This expansive area is beautifully presented with a modern finish and flooded with natural light. The standout feature here is the stunning outlook, with panoramic views across the coast, offering a constantly changing and truly special backdrop. A private balcony extends from the living area, providing the perfect spot for a morning coffee or evening glass of wine while taking in the scenery.

To the front, the main bedroom is a spacious and elegant retreat, featuring a charming bay window, ample storage and a well-appointed en-suite. It’s a room that perfectly reflects the sense of luxury found throughout the apartment.

The second bedroom is a comfortable double, centrally positioned within the property and ideal for guests, a home office or additional living space. A modern family bathroom serves this room and the rest of the apartment.

The Exterior

The development benefits from secure and sheltered underground parking, complete with an electric vehicle charging point, as well as additional visitor parking. The communal grounds are attractively landscaped and well cared for, enhancing the overall setting. A particularly valuable addition is the generous internal storage unit, offering garage-like space ideal for bikes, tools or outdoor equipment.

The Location

Located in the heart of Deganwy, the property is just a short distance from the vibrant high street, offering a selection of shops, cafés and restaurants. A local grocery store is conveniently nearby, along with easy access to the train station, beach and the A55 for commuting. Deganwy Marina, the Quay Hotel and the historic town of Conwy are all within close reach, making this an ideal location for both lifestyle and connectivity.
